Kumbharbadi - Daringbadi, Kandhamal

Kumbharbadi is a village situated in the Daringbadi tehsil of Kandhamal district, Odisha. It is located approximately 13 km from the tehsil headquarters in Daringbadi and around 143 km from the district headquarters in Phulbani. Siangbali ser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kumbharbadi village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kumbharbadi is 417476. The village covers a total geographical area of 144 hectares and falls under the 762104 pincode. Surada is the nearest town, located about 60 km away.

Kumbharbadi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the G. udayagiri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kandhamal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Kumbharbadi

According to the 2011 Census, Kumbharbadi village had a total population of 289 people, including 132 males and 157 females, living in 82 households. The sex ratio was 1,189 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 69.04%, with male literacy at 80.00% and female literacy at 60.45%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 168,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 65.
